Release channel: Telemetry payload compression ships in Murkwater 3.8. Zstd level 3, dictionary trained on last quarter's traffic. Wire size down ~62%, CPU overhead negligible on agents. Rollout: canary fleet tonight, full fleet Thursday if error budget holds. Old agents fall back to uncompressed; no coordination needed. Rollback is a single flag flip. Dashboards updated with compressed/uncompressed ratio panels. Ping me before promoting. The canary build is identified by the token below.

pipeline stamp: htk21_86b657ac0aa916a9af17f

Break-glass for the Haulline migration (homegrown queue → Driftbelt). Release manager only. Use if the cutover stalls with jobs stranded in the legacy tables and the rollback script cannot authenticate. Do not touch the dual-write flags manually; the break-glass tool reconciles them. Steps: freeze deploys, page the Driftbelt owner, run the break-glass unlocker from the bastion, then re-drain the legacy queue. The unlocker asks for the migration recovery passphrase, and the current value is maintained immediately below this paragraph.

vault phrase of bawig-tawef = briix-ralath

**Mgmt Meeting Minutes — Retiring the Brightline Range**

Quick recap for sales leads at Fenholt Supplies: we agreed to retire the Brightline fixture range by year-end. Remaining stock moves to clearance pricing next month, and accounts on standing orders get migrated to the Lumetta range. Trade-in incentives were approved in principle. The confidential note on next steps sits just below.

board note of bajof-bajeg: The pricing group signed off on a budget of $13.4 million for Project Sildor. The renewal with Lamixek Holdings closes at $48.9 million a year, 49 percent above the last contract.

## Support Onboarding: PodCheckly

Welcome aboard! PodCheckly is our feed validator — support folks run it locally to reproduce customer feed errors. Grab the repo, copy `.env.example` to `.env`, and set `PODCHECKLY_MODE=support` so you hit the replay sandbox instead of live feeds. One more thing: right under that, add the line that sets the replay API secret.

sealed setting: LEDGER_TOKEN29=130a4f7ada97c8be1e00128e577ab